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court addressed the retirement age of employees at I.I.T. Kanpur, specifically under Statute 13 of the Institutes of Technology Act, 1961. The Court held that the age of superannuation for the respondent, an Assistant Registrar, was correctly set at 60 years as per the existing statutes and amendments, and that the communication from the Ministry of Human Resource Development suggesting a retirement age of 62 years for university teachers did not apply to non-faculty staff like the respondent. Consequently, the Court upheld the decision of I.I.T. Kanpur regarding the respondent's retirement age, affirming the validity of the statutes governing service conditions.
